How to Track Ontime Shipments with Ship24

If you're expecting a delivery, knowing how to track an Ontime package using Ship24 can help you stay informed throughout the shipping process. With just a tracking number, you can access real-time updates and follow your parcel from dispatch to delivery.

Steps to Track Ontime Packages Using Ship24

Tracking your Ontime shipment with Ship24 is quick and user-friendly. Follow these steps to check your delivery status:

  1. Find your tracking number – This number is usually provided by the sender or retailer after your order is confirmed. You can locate it in your shipping confirmation email or order details page.
  2. Visit the Ship24 tracking page – Go to the Ship24 website and navigate to the tracking section.
  3. Enter the Ontime tracking number – Input the tracking number into the search bar and click the search icon.
  4. View the shipment tracking details – Ship24 will display the latest shipping updates, including transit checkpoints, customs clearance, and delivery progress.

Once entered, you’ll see a complete timeline of your Ontime parcel tracking, including location scans and estimated delivery times. This helps you stay aligned with your delivery schedule and plan ahead.

Understanding Shipping Status and Transit Information

As your package moves through the shipping route, tracking updates will reflect its current status. Here’s a breakdown of common Ontime tracking statuses you may encounter on Ship24:

Tracking Status Description
Shipment Created The sender has generated a tracking number, but the package has not yet been picked up.
In Transit The package is moving between locations or logistics hubs.
Out for Delivery The parcel is on the final delivery route to your address.
Delivered The shipment has been successfully delivered to the recipient.
Exception There is an issue such as a customs delay, incorrect address, or attempted delivery.

These updates offer clarity on your package tracking and help you understand where your item is within the global shipping process.

Troubleshooting Tracking Issues with Ontime Shipments

Sometimes, tracking updates may not appear as expected. If you're having trouble with your Ontime tracking number or shipment status, here are some common issues and how to handle them.

Tracking Number Not Updating or Invalid

If your tracking number returns no results, it may be due to:

  • The package not yet being scanned into the Ontime system
  • A delay in the first tracking update after shipment creation
  • Incorrect entry of the tracking number

Double-check the number and try again after a few hours. If the issue persists, contact the sender or Ontime customer service for confirmation.

Shipment Delays and What They Mean

Delays can happen due to weather, customs, or logistical issues. If your Ontime package is marked as “In Transit” for an extended period, it may be stuck at a hub or awaiting customs clearance.

Use Ship24 to see the last recorded location and status. If no updates appear for several days, it may be worth contacting the courier for more details.

Steps to Take When Your Delivery Status Is Unclear

If your Ontime tracking status is stuck or unclear, follow these steps:

  1. Check Ship24 for the latest update and timestamp
  2. Compare the status with the expected delivery window
  3. Contact the sender or courier if there’s no movement for several days

Ship24 provides a detailed tracking history to help you identify where the package may be delayed or rerouted. This is particularly helpful for international parcel tracking where multiple checkpoints are involved.

Typical Ontime Shipping Times and Delivery Schedule

Shipping times can vary depending on the destination, type of service, and possible delays during transit. Understanding estimated delivery windows can help you manage expectations and plan accordingly.

Domestic shipments with Ontime often take 1 to 3 business days, depending on the express or standard service chosen. Delivery schedules generally run during local business hours, Monday to Saturday in most regions.

For international shipments, transit times can range from 5 to 15 business days, depending on customs procedures, shipping routes, and whether the parcel is sent via air or ground transport. Real-time tracking allows you to monitor each stage—hub transfers, customs, and final mile delivery—so you can better forecast when your parcel will arrive.
